Purpose
It is essential that hospitals and health professionals establish systems to facilitate patients’ organ donation wishes. Donation education has been neither standardized nor systematic, and resources related to donation processes have not been widely accessible. This report describes 2 free, publicly available educational resources about the organ donation process created to advance the mission of basic education and improve donation processes within hospitals and health care systems.
The two resources referenced are the Organ Donation Toolbox and the Educational Training Video “Saving and Healing Lives through Organ and Tissue Donation”
